在本文中,我们将通过一个实例来详细讲解如何开发一个PHP全站系统。以下是一个简单的项目结构,以及各个模块的功能和实现方法。

模块功能实现方法
用户模块处理用户注册、登录、信息修改等使用PHP的session和cookie技术
商品模块管理商品信息,包括添加、修改、删除等使用MySQL数据库存储商品信息
订单模块处理订单的生成、修改、删除等使用PHP和MySQL数据库进行操作
访问统计模块统计网站访问量、用户行为等使用PHP和MySQL数据库进行数据统计
留言板模块允许用户发表留言,管理员可以删除留言使用PHP和MySQL数据库存储留言信息

用户模块

功能:处理用户注册、登录、信息修改等。

实例PHP全站系统开发详解 湿度调节

实现方法

1. 注册:用户填写注册信息,系统验证信息后,将用户信息存储到MySQL数据库中。

2. 登录:用户输入用户名和密码,系统验证后,使用session和cookie技术记录用户登录状态。

3. 信息修改:用户登录后,可以修改个人信息,系统更新数据库中的信息。

商品模块

功能:管理商品信息,包括添加、修改、删除等。

实现方法

1. 商品添加:管理员在后台添加商品信息,包括商品名称、价格、库存等,系统将信息存储到MySQL数据库中。

2. 商品修改:管理员可以修改商品信息,系统更新数据库中的信息。

3. 商品删除:管理员可以删除商品信息,系统从数据库中删除相关数据。

订单模块

功能:处理订单的生成、修改、删除等。

实现方法

1. 订单生成:用户下单后,系统生成订单信息,包括订单号、商品信息、用户信息等,存储到MySQL数据库中。

2. 订单修改:用户或管理员可以修改订单信息,系统更新数据库中的信息。

3. 订单删除:用户或管理员可以删除订单信息,系统从数据库中删除相关数据。

访问统计模块

功能:统计网站访问量、用户行为等。

实现方法

1. 访问量统计:系统记录每个页面的访问量,存储到MySQL数据库中。

2. 用户行为统计:系统记录用户在网站上的行为,如浏览、搜索、购买等,存储到MySQL数据库中。

留言板模块

功能:允许用户发表留言,管理员可以删除留言。

实现方法

1. 留言发表:用户填写留言信息,系统将信息存储到MySQL数据库中。

2. 留言删除:管理员可以删除留言,系统从数据库中删除相关数据。

通过以上实例,我们可以了解到PHP全站系统的基本结构和实现方法。在实际开发过程中,可以根据需求对系统进行扩展和优化。